Transaction 590980de9a56cd4aab7af58b0681fa81664a93e1eb287aab2337fe6cb790581f
1 Input
1 Output
-
590980de9a56cd4aab7af58b0681fa81664a93e1eb287aab2337fe6cb790581f:0
- value
- 651650
- script pubkey
- OP_0 OP_PUSHBYTES_32 a17090cd0ae44c3ffe2ab3c76b0c55514fb19e6e468403b56e749d45a8ffda2e
- address
- bc1q59cfpng2u3xrll32k0rkkrz4298mr8nwg6zq8dtwwjw5t28lmghqs5g0e8